  • We investigated emission characteristics of tandem organic light emitting devices (OLEDs) with p-type materials as charge generation layer. The tandem OLEDs were fabricated by using $MoO_x$, $WO_x$, C60 and HATCN as p-type material or not using p-type material for charge generation. When HATCN was used as p-type material, it showed high current density at low applied voltage, but increase of efficiency was small because of charge unbalance in emitting layer. In case of tandem OLED not using p-type material, applied voltage increased remarkably because of difficulty of hole injection. In case of $MoO_x$, $WO_x$ or C60 as p-type material, current emission efficiency increased greatly. In particular, current emission efficiency of tandem OLED using $MoO_x$ as p-type material increased up to 3 times than current emission efficiency of single OLED. The Commission Internationale de l'Eclairage (CIE) 1931 color coordinates were changed by overlapping of 504 nm emission wavelength. As a result, emission efficiency of tandem OLED improved compared with single OLED, but driving voltage also increased by increase of organic layer thickness.

  • To operate organic light emitting device (OLED) with alternating current (AC) power source without AC/DC(direct current) converter, we fabricated the fluorescent OLED and measured the emission characteristics with AC and DC. The OLED operated by AC showed higher maximum current efficiency of 8.2 cd/A and maximum power efficiency of 8.3 lm/W. But current efficiency and power efficiency of AC driven OLED showed worse than DC driven OLED at high voltage above 10 V. This result can be explained by the peak voltage of AC was $\sqrt{2}$ times than DC, In case of low driving voltage the emission characteristics were improved by the peak voltage of AC, but in case of high driving voltage the emission efficiencies were decreased by the roll off phenomena. Finally, serial OLED arrays using twelve OLEDs driven by AC 110 V showed average voltage of 9.17 V, voltage uniformity of 99.0%, average luminance of $1,175cd/m^2$, luminance uniformity of 94.4%.

  • In this work, we have investigated the characteristics of the phosphorescent OLED and flexible OLED fabricated on IZTO/glass and IZTO/PET anode film grown by magnetron sputtering, respectively. Electrical and optical characteristics of amorphous IZTO/glass anode exhibited similar to commercial ITO anode even though it was deposited at room temperature. In addition, the amorphous IZTO anode showed higher work function than that of the commercial ITO anode after ozone treatment for 10 minutes. Furthermore, a phosphorescent OLED fabricated on amorphous IZTO anode film showed improved current-voltage-luminance characteristics, external quantum efficiency and power efficiency in contrast with phosphorescent OLED fabricated on commercial ITO anode film. This indicates that IZTO anode is promising alternative anode materials for anode in OLEDs and flexible OLEDs.

  • To study the encapsulation method for large-area organic light emitting devices (OLEDs), OLED of ITO / 2-TNATA / NPB / $Alq_3$:Rubrene / $Alq_3$ / LiF / Al structure was fabricated, which on $Alq_3$/LiF/Al as protective layer of OLED was deposited to protect the damage of OLED, and subsequently it was encapsulated using attaching film and flat glass. The current density and luminance of encapsulated OLED using attaching film and flat glass has similar characteristics compared with non-encapsulated OLED when thickness of Al as a protective layer was 1200 nm, otherwise power efficiency of encapsulated OLED was better than non-encapsulated OLED. Encapsulation process using attaching film and flat glass did not have any effects on the emission spectrum and the Commission International de L'Eclairage (CIE) coordinate. The lifetime of encapsulated OLED using attaching film and flat glass was 287 hours in 1200 nm Al thickness, which was increased according to thickness of Al protective layer, and was improved 54% compared with 186 hours in same Al thickness, lifetime of encapsulated OLED using epoxy and flat glass. As a result, it showed the improved efficiency and the long lifetime, because the encapsulation method using attaching film and flat glass could minimize the impact on OLED caused through UV hardening process in case of glass encapsulation using epoxy.

  • The global small and mid-sized display market is changing from thin film transistor-liquid crystal display to organic light emitting diode (OLED). Reflecting these market conditions, the domestic and overseas display panel industry is making great effort to innovate OLED technology and incease productivity. However, current OLED production technology has not been able to satisfy the quality requirement levels by customers, as the market demand for OLED is becoming more and more diversified. In addition, as OLED panel production technology levels to satisfy customers' requirement become higher, product quality problems are persistently generated in OLED deposition process. These problems not only decrease the production yield but also cause a second problem of deteriorating productivity. Based on these observations, in this study, we suggest TRIZ-based improvement of defects caused by glass pixel position deformation, which is one of quality deterioration problems in small and medium OLED deposition process. Specifically, we derive various factors affecting the glass pixel position shift by using cause and effect diagram and identify radical reasons by using XY-matrix. As a result, it is confirmed that glass heat distortion due to the high temperature of the OLED deposition process is the most influential factor in the glass pixel position shift. In order to solve the identified factors, we analyzed the cause and mechanism of glass thermal deformation. We suggest an efficient method to minimize glass thermal deformation by applying the improvement plan of facilities using contradiction matrix in TRIZ. We show that the suggested method can decrease the glass temperature change by about 23% through an experiment.

  • The net effect of the emitter orientation, Mie scatters, and pillow lenses on the outcoupling efficiency (OCE) of a bottom-emitting OLED having an internal photonic crystal layer was investigated by a combined optical simulation based on the finite-difference time-domain method (FDTD) and the ray-tracing technique. The simulation showed that when the emitter orientation was horizontal with respect to the OLED surface, the OCE could be increased by 54% when a photonic crystal layer was employed, while it could be improved by 86% under optimized conditions of Mie scatters and pillow lenses applied to the glass substrate. The peculiar intensity distribution of the OLED, caused by the periodic lattice structure of the photonic crystal layer, could be ameliorated by inserting Mie scatters into the glass substrate. This study suggests that conventional outcoupling structures combined with control of the emitter orientation could improve the OCE substantially.

  • We studied the blue fluorescent OLED with Mg:Ag, Al, Ni as anode materials. Blue fluorescent OLEDs were fabricated using Anode / $MoO_3$ (3 nm) / 2-TNATA (60 nm) / NPB (30 nm) / SH-1 : BD-2 (5 vol.%, 30 nm) / Bphen (40 nm) / Liq (1 nm) / Al (150 nm). Current density of OLED with Mg:Ag was not measured due to too low work function, and that of OLED with Al showed $45.2mA/cm^2$ at 12 V. Luminance and Current efficiency of OLED with Al showed $385.1cd/m^2$ and 0.9 cd/A. Current density of OLED with Ni of 8, 10, 12 nm thickness showed 10, 12.9, $37.2mA/cm^2$, respectively. Luminance and Current efficiency of OLED with Ni of 8, 10, 12 nm thickness showed 670.9, 991.2, $1,320cd/m^2$ and 6.7, 7.7, 3.6 cd/A, respectively. Transmittance of Al was 52.2% at 476 nm wavelength and that of Ni of 8, 10, 12 nm thickness was 79, 77, 74 %, respectively. In spite of best current density, OLED with Al showed the lowest luminance and current efficiency because of low work function and poor transmittance. When thickness of Ni was increased to 12nm, current efficiency was sharply lower owing to bad transmittance and unbalance of holes and electrons. Finally, OLED with Ni of 10 nm thicknes showed the highest current efficiency.

  • The light extraction efficiency of top-emitting organic light-emitting diode (OLED) was improved by insertion of corrugation patterns between indium tin oxide and organic layers. The corrugation patterns was fabricated by nanosphere lithography, which could form a self-assembled particle monolayer over a large area. The electrical and optical properties for the OLED devices fabricated by vacuum evaporation, were investigated. We have demonstrated the enhancement of the power efficiency of corrugated OLED. As a result, the power efficiency of the corrugated OLED was found to be more than 42%.

  • OLED driving voltage shift can reduce the OLED display lifetime, especially for digitally driven AMOLED. By operating OLED at high frequency, we were able to suppress OLED voltage shift degradation, expecting improved AMOLED lifetime. We describe frequency dependence of voltage shift obtained from bias stress test of OLED.
